Fuel Barge Briefly Aground Near Kodiak

Jay Barrett/KMXT

A 382-foot barge carrying 2.2-million gallons of fuel was briefly aground on Saturday, two miles from Kodiak City. The “DBL-106” refloated on the next tide, but the Coast Guard ordered it to anchor up until a damage assessment was conducted. The 124-foot tug Bismark Sea, owned by Kirby Offshore Marine, was the towing vessel.

There was no immediate sign of pollution as a result of the grounding, and the barge was to have been boomed off until a damage assessment was conducted.

There were no injuries in the incident, and weather at the time included 15 mph winds and 3- to 4-foot seas.
